### Circuit breaker sizing — Lanternfall upstream

The breaker guards calls to the Lanternfall quote API. When failures cross the threshold it opens, sheds load, and probes periodically before closing. These constants were derived from the upstream's published latency percentiles plus our own retry budget. Please review them carefully before changing anything; the current values follow.

constants for bagaf-hadup:
QUOTAS = {
    "quenael": 1,
    "ralwyn": 1,
    "oliath": 2,
    "ulaael": 2,
}

Subject: Cut-over complete — Ordents ledger partitioning

Hi,

The Ordents ledger tables are now partitioned by month as planned. Backfill of historical rows finished overnight, and query routing switched to the partitioned set this morning with no errors. Old monolithic tables stay read-only for two weeks before drop. The partitioning settings now active in production are listed below.

deployment values, hahip-kajep:
HOLAX_PIN=4003
HOLAX_METRICS_HOST=metrics.holax.zemvarworks.internal
HOLAX_LOG_LEVEL=warn
HOLAX_TENANT=fraael

**CI note: timezone weirdness in report exports**

Heads up, support folks — if a customer says their Ledgerpine export shows times shifted by a few hours, it's probably the CI image. The export workers got rebuilt last week and the base image defaults to UTC, while older workers used the account's locale. Fix is rolling out; meanwhile tell customers the data itself is fine, just the display offset. Affected exports carry the build token shown below.

build token for bajof-tahop: htk4_a981

Handover — from Priya to Callum, cc Finance

Callum, quick one: the big-deal discount policy is mid-revision. Anything over 20% on Lanternworks contracts currently needs my sign-off — that's yours now. Finance has the draft thresholds; don't publish until the Bramleigh renewal closes. The context behind the timing is summarised just below.

board note of bawep-tajef: Queniusek Systems plans to raise the Quenvan list price by 53.1 percent in March. The pricing group signed off on a budget of $176.4 million for Project Drueth. The renewal with Casionix Partners closes at $142.5 million a year, 8.3 percent below the last contract. Project Fraax slips by six weeks because of the tooling delay.